Ketone bodies and ketone body esters as blood lipid lowering agents

Abstract

The subject disclosure provides compositions for reducing serum cholesterol and/or triglyceride levels in subjects. These compositions can comprise racemic β-hydroxybutyrate or D-β-hydroxybutyrate, optionally in the acid form, physiologically compatible salts of racemic β-hydroxybutyrate or D-β-hydroxybutyrate, esters of D-β-hydroxybutyrate, oligomers of D-β-hydroxybutyrate containing from 2 to 20 or more monomeric units in either linear or cyclic form, racemic 1,3 butandiol or R-1,3 butandiol alone and can be, optionally, administered in conjunction with a low fat diet to a subject. Alternatively, compositions comprising racemic β-hydroxybutyrate or D-β-hydroxybutyrate, optionally in the acid form, physiologically compatible salts of racemic β-hydroxybutyrate or D-β-hydroxybutyrate, esters of D-β-hydroxybutyrate, oligomers of D-β-hydroxybutyrate containing from 2 to 20 or more monomeric units in either linear or cyclic form, racemic 1,3 butandiol, R-1,3 butandiol or combinations thereof can be formulated as nutritional supplements (also referred to as nutritional compositions) or incorporated into therapeutic compositions containing a) anti-hypertensive agents; b) anti-inflammatory agents; c) glucose lowering agents; or d) anti-lipemic agents) which are administered to a subject, optionally in combination with a low fat diet, in order to cause a reduction or lowering of: serum cholesterol levels; triglyceride levels; serum glucose levels, serum homocysteine levels, inflammatory proteins (e.g., C reactive protein) and/or hypertension in treated subjects. Alternatively, compositions disclosed herein can be administered alone, or in combination with other therapeutic agents to prevent or reverse vascular disease.

Claims (18)

1. A method for lowering serum glucose levels in a diabetic subject in need thereof comprising the oral administration of a composition comprising an R-1,3-butanediol ester of monomeric D -β-hydroxybutyrate alone, or in combination with an additional therapeutic agent, to a subject so as to raise blood D -β-hydroxybutyrate plus acetoacetate from between 0.1 to 20 mM.

2. The method according to claim 1 , wherein said composition is administered in the form of the subject's diet.

3. The method according to claim 1 , wherein said method comprises the administration of a first composition comprising the R-1,3-butanediol ester of monomeric D -β-hydroxybutyrate in combination with a second composition comprising a therapeutic agent, wherein said first and second compositions are administered separately, sequentially or together and each composition is in unit dosage form.

4. The method according to claim 3 , wherein said therapeutic agent is selected from glucose/blood sugar lowering agents, lipid lowering (anti-lipemic) agents, blood pressure lowering agents (anti-hypertensive agents), or agents that reduce inflammation (anti-inflammatory agents).

5. The method according to claim 1 , wherein said method lowers blood sugar in a diabetic subject without inducing insulin shock and comprises administering the said composition in unit dosage form or feeding the diabetic subject a diet containing the said composition.

6. The method according to claim 1 , wherein said method lowers or reduces elevated blood homocysteine and comprises administering the said composition in unit dosage form or feeding the diabetic subject a diet containing the said composition.

7. The method according to claim 1 , wherein said method lowers or reduces serum C-reactive protein levels and comprises administering the said composition in unit dosage form or feeding the diabetic subject a diet containing the said composition.

8. The method according to claim 1 , wherein said method lowers or reduces blood pressure levels in a subject and comprises administering the said composition in unit dosage form or feeding the diabetic subject a diet containing the said composition.

9. The method according to claim 1 , wherein the dietary intake of fat by said subject is reduced.

10. The method according to claim 1 , wherein the R-1,3-butanediol ester of monomeric D -β-hydroxybutyrate is administered in an amount that a) provides for blood levels of D -β-hydroxybutyrate plus acetoacetate ranging from between 0.1 to 25 mM, between 0.4 to 10 mM or between 0.6 and 3 mM in an individual; or b) ranges from 2-100% of the total caloric intake of an individual, 5-70% of the total caloric intake of an individual, or 5-30% of the total caloric intake of the individual.

11. The method according to claim 1 , wherein said method raises blood D -β-hydroxybutyrate plus acetoacetate from between 0.5 and 10 mM.

12. The method according to claim 1 , wherein said method raises blood D -β-hydroxybutyrate plus acetoacetate from between 1 to 3 mM.

13. A method of reducing serum glucose levels in a diabetic subject in need thereof, comprising administering an R-1,3-butanediol ester of monomeric D -β-hydroxybutyrate in combination with a therapeutic agent selected from:

a) anti-lipemic agents;

b) anti-hypertensive agents;

c) glucose lowering agents; or

d) anti-inflammatory agents

to a diabetic subject.
